International Ministry Team

The membership of the International Ministry Team (IMT) consists of the International Policy Council members plus regional representatives from around the world, with Steve Murrell serving as president. The roles and responsibilities of the IMT are as follows:

1. To provide a global perspective for the leadership and oversight of Every Nation Churches and Ministries;

2. To train and develop Regional Directors; and

3. To fulfill their own roles as Regional Directors, whose responsibilities are as follows:

• Provide pastoral support and encouragement to the region’s leaders
• Communicate Every Nation’s vision and values
• Facilitate conferences, staff meetings and other regional events
• Help train and appoint elders
• Mediate church conflicts
• Coordinate regional church planting and mission efforts
• Understand and support core ministries and their policies
